Sorry, yes it is for a DII. It will work on a DI, but will hang over a bit.
And yes it is a great rack! I would keep it, but we may be selling the Disco and I'd thought I'd try to sell it rather than keep it with the truck. The rack has extra floor tubing so it was easier to strap things down. Their price is right on, I looked at SD racks and just couldn't justify spending that much... Great racks, but for my use not worth paying more for them. I talked with a guy that had a SD rack and he was more impressed with mine, he said he'd rather have the extra support when he has his tent set up on it...
